The ingredients needed to make Banana cupcakes:
- Get 3/4 cups Brown Sugar
- Prepare 1/4 cup oil
- Get 1.5 cup All-purpose Flour
- Take 1 tsp Baking Powder
- Take 1/2 tsp Baking Soda
- Make ready 1 pinch Salt
- Take 2 Mashed Ripe Bananas
- Take 3/4 cup milk
- Make ready 1/2 cup Chocolate Chips
- Make ready Handful walnuts chopped
Steps to make Banana cupcakes:
- Mash the bananas with a fork In a blender
- Cream sugar and oil for about 5 minutes
- Add vanilla essence
- Sieve flour, baking powder, baking soda and salt in a bowl
- Add the dry ingredients to the creamed mixture
- The batter will be thick.add milk
- Include walnuts and chocolate chips keeping a few for the top layer.
- Line and grease the cupcake moulds or baking pan
- Pour in the mixture - Bake for 25-30 minutes in a preheated oven at 200 degrees
- Check with a skewer test
- Remove when done
- Cool it over a rack and enjoy when cooled
- I got one loaf and six cupcakes with this batter
